Repetitive Transcranial Magnetic Stimulation (rTMS) of the Dorsolateral Prefrontal Cortex Reduces Resting-State Insula Activity and Modulates Functional Connectivity of the Orbitofrontal Cortex in Cigarette Smokers
BACKGROUND: Previous studies reported that repetitive transcranial magnetic stimulation (rTMS) can reduce cue-elicited craving and decrease cigarette consumption in smokers.
